What you'll learn
Implement conditional logic using boolean comparison operators, complex nested if-else structures, and Python's match-case statement.
Build efficient for and while loops alongside advanced list comprehensions to traverse multi-dimensional data structures.
Structure reusable code by writing custom functions with variable scopes and establishing object-oriented classes with inheritance.
Data files for this course are provided in the first course of this specialization, "Intro to Python: Setup and Data Processing".
